Introduction

Insulation materials play a critical role in enhancing indoor comfort by controlling temperature and humidity. However, the performance of these materials can fluctuate significantly with varying humidity levels, affecting both their efficiency and lifespan.

Overview of Insulation Materials

Insulation materials are specifically engineered to resist heat transfer, which boosts energy efficiency in residential and commercial buildings. Popular insulation types include fiberglass, foam, cellulose, and mineral wool. Each type possesses distinct moisture absorption characteristics, essential for their overall performance. For example, high humidity conditions can trigger condensation within wall assemblies, undermining the effectiveness of insulation and potentially leading to mold development.

  • Fiberglass: Generally has moisture resistance but may lose efficiency if it becomes saturated due to improper installation or unmanaged moisture.
  • Foam: Closed-cell foam provides superior moisture resistance, while open-cell foam is more vulnerable to moisture absorption, affecting performance in humid conditions.
  • Cellulose: Known to absorb moisture but can significantly diminish insulation capabilities if overly saturated or untreated against pests.
  • Mineral Wool: Offers good moisture resistance and maintains performance even in humid environments, although excessive dampness can still negatively impact thermal efficiency.

Impact of Humidity on Insulation Performance

Evaluating how insulation materials perform under various humidity conditions requires considering several essential factors. These factors include moisture absorption rates, alterations in thermal conductivity, and the risk of biological contaminants such as mold and mildew. Selecting insulation suited to your area’s humidity characteristics is crucial.

  • Moisture absorption: Elevated humidity can increase the moisture levels in insulation materials, leading to reduced effectiveness, particularly in cellulose and open-cell foam varieties.
  • Thermal conductivity variation: Some insulating materials may have decreased thermal efficiency when wet, notably impacting energy savings for cellulose and open-cell foam.
  • Growth of biological contaminants: High moisture levels can encourage mold and mildew proliferation, damaging insulation and structural components. Implementing appropriate vapor barriers and ventilation is essential to control these risks.

Conclusion

In summary, insulation materials do not perform uniformly under varying humidity levels. Knowing how different insulation types react to moisture is essential for selecting the right insulation for your specific climate conditions.
